Chasing a goal at Ekana Stadium, Lucknow, underneath the lights was by no means simple till Rishabh Pant and his boys confirmed how one can do it. On Friday night time, the Delhi Capitals (DC) turned the first staff ever to efficiently chase a complete of greater than 160 in opposition to Lucknow Super Giants (LSG). DC defeated LSG by 6 wickets to register their second win this season, leaping as much as the 9th spot on the factors desk.

DC beat LSG by 6 wickets

DC showcased what’s required to beat LSG on their very own turf. The observe turned slower, not a lot on provide for the pacers and that’s what the guests capitalized on. Chasing 168, debutant Jake Fraser-McGurk and Pant struck a 77-run partnership to take the match away from the hosts. The uncapped Australian batter introduced himself with a belligerent half-century on his IPL debut after spinner Kuldeep Yadav dazzled with the ball, choosing up 3-wicket on his return.

Had Ravi Bishnoi not dropped Fraser-McGurk in the 8th over off Marcus Stoinis’ bowling, LSG may have maintained their successful spree in the match. But the Aussie batter made the most of the second probability he obtained and took the recreation away from the hosts. Lucknow captain KL Rahul highlighted that large miss, lauding the DC debutant for his fearless strategy.

“He (Jake Fraser-McGurk) hit the ball well, credit to him. We always walk in with the same mindset, and want to hit the right areas. We got Warner in the powerplay and got a couple of wickets after the powerplay. The set batters – Pant and McGurk took the game away from us after that dropped catch,” Rahul advised the broadcasters after the 7-wicket defeat.

The LSG captain additionally heaped reward on Kuldeep, who snared three wickets which included the prized scalp of Nicholas Pooran. The DC leggie bamboozled the in-form Pooran, who seemed clueless as the ball uprooted the off stump.

“In hindsight, you can always wonder if you could have done something different. There wasn’t much spin after Axar’s over, so I thought Pooran could have put some pressure on the opposition if he was set. He would have been dangerous, but credit to Kuldeep for getting him out,” Rahul added.

‘Need to protect Mayank Yadav’s physique’

Young tempo sensation Mayank Yadav was benched on Friday as the teenager suffered a hip harm in LSG’s earlier encounter in opposition to Gujarat Titans. Rahul stated the Delhi pacer is doing high-quality however the staff administration wouldn’t rush him at this stage.

“He (Mayank Yadav) is feeling good, he looks good, but we don’t want to rush him. We need to protect his body, he’s itching to go. Need to make sure that he’s hundred percent (fit) before he comes back,” Rahul concluded.
